Output d51a076654de70b0ddc2acd23445c427f00a6dc3dfe8ea283f43d251fa15de0a:0

value
25243
script pubkey
OP_0 OP_PUSHBYTES_20 ed85c1ee027b7ab6cae78e78fc5da31b755c9774
address
bc1qakzurmsz0datdjh83eu0chdrrd64e9m50j43p4
transaction
d51a076654de70b0ddc2acd23445c427f00a6dc3dfe8ea283f43d251fa15de0a
confirmations
2346
spent
false